Four Crosses 3 Rhayader Town 0

KYLE Wilson struck twice as Four Crosses ended a promotion winning campaign with the ER Jenkins Cup.

Crosses had twice gone close through Jordan Gerrard who made the breakthrough by heading home Shin Miah’s corner.

Rhayader ended the half on top but Crosses firm until the break.

Crosses went close at the start of the second-half with Jamie Evans rattling the with a headed effort before the villagers doubled their lead with Wilson opening his account with a low free-kick.

Despite being reduced to 10 men with the dismissal of Harry Davies the Rhayader side were unable to make their numerical advantage count and were soon down to 10 men themselves.

It was all over when Wilson completed his brace with a stunning free-kick to ensure the trophy for the Montgomeryshire side.

The evening ended with Rhayader reduced to nine men before Crosses celebrated the end of a glorious campaign and promotion back to MMP-NL Mid Wales League One with the ER Jenkins Cup.
